Start your Australian adventure by arriving in Sydney, the bustling capital city of New South Wales. In the morning, take in the breathtaking views of the Sydney Opera House and Sydney Harbour Bridge from the Royal Botanic Garden. Spend the afternoon exploring the iconic Bondi Beach, known for its golden sands and vibrant surf culture. In the evening, head to The Rocks, a historic area with cobblestone streets, for delicious dinner options.
Experience the charm of Melbourne, known for its artsy laneways and vibrant café culture. Start your day with a visit to Federation Square, a bustling hub for art, culture, and events. Explore the hidden laneways and street art of Hosier Lane in the afternoon. As the evening arrives, imm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of Southbank Promenade, lined with restaurants and bars.
Embark on an unforgettable day trip to the Great Barrier Reef,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the seven natural wonders of the world. Take a snorkeling or diving tour to discover the vibrant coral reefs and marine life. Marvel at the breathtaking beauty of this underwater paradise. Return to your accommodation in the evening and relax after a day of adventure.
Fly to Ayers Rock, also known as Uluru, in the heart of the Australian Outback. Start your day with a sunrise tour of Uluru, a massive sandstone monolith. Learn about its cultural and spiritual significance to the Aboriginal people. In the afternoon, explore the breathtaking Kata Tjuta (The Olgas), a series of large rock formations. End the day with a mesmerizing sunset view of Uluru.
Head to Brisbane, the capital of Queensland, and start your day with a relaxing river cruise along the Brisbane River. Enjoy the scenic views of the city skyline, lush parks, and iconic bridges. In the afternoon, explore the South Bank Parklands, a vibrant cultural and recreational precinct. Visit the Queensland Art Gallery and Gallery of Modern Art for a dose of art and culture.
Travel to Adelaide, the capital city of South Australia, known for its famous wine regions. Start your day by visiting the Adelaide Central Market, a bustling food market offering a wide range of local produce. In the afternoon, embark on a wine tasting tour in the nearby Barossa Valley or McLaren Vale, renowned for their world-class wines. Enjoy the picturesque vineyards and sample some of Australia's finest wines.
Conclude your Australian journey in the Gold Coast, a coastal city known for its beautiful beaches and thrilling theme parks. Spend the morning at Surfers Paradise Beach, where you can relax, swim, or try your hand at surfing. Afterward, visit one of the theme parks, such as Dreamworld or Warner Bros. Movie World, for an exciting afternoon filled with thrilling rides and entertainment.
While exploring Australia, don't miss the stunning Blue Mountains near Sydney, where you can hike through ancient valleys and marvel at breathtaking vistas. In Melbourne, venture to St Kilda Beach for a relaxed beachside vibe and stunning sunsets. For a unique wildlife encounter, visit Kangaroo Island in Adelaide, home to diverse wildlife including kangaroos, koalas, and sea lions.
